Donahue Sr.                                                                    1930-2007   Chicopee- David "Dave" Ambrose Donahue Sr., 77, a life long Chicopee resident entered into eternal rest on Saturday March 10, 2007 in Baystate Medical Center in Springfield. He was born in Chicopee Falls on February 11, 1930 a son of the late Joseph and Elizabeth (Brown) Donahue. Dave attended St. Patrick's School in Chicopee and graduated from Cathedral High School in Springfield. He was a communicant of St. George Church, was a 50 year friend of Bill W, and was a member of the Knights of Columbus Elder Council 69 in Chicopee. Dave was a self employed distributor for McKee Baking Company, and after retirement was employed at Sunshine Village as a driver. He was a good story teller and was an avid New York Yankees fan. Dave enjoyed bird watching, photography, music, and playing cribbage with his friends. He received the most enjoyment when he was spending time with his grandchildren.
